This week the Deacons will face off against the Towson Tigers in their first home game of the year.
For those of you who may not know, the Tigers are an FCS school and a member of the Colonial Athletic Association or CAA. The team and their whole conference have been overshadowed by the play of James Madison University for the past five seasons.
